Fintech Engineer Skill
Overview
Financial technology engineering covering payment processing, ledger design, compliance, security, and fintech API integration. Core principle: correctness over speed — financial bugs have real monetary consequences.
Critical Rules
IRON LAWS OF FINANCIAL ENGINEERING:
1. Monetary values = integers (cents/pence/satoshis) — NEVER floats
2. All writes are idempotent (idempotency keys on every mutation)
3. Double-entry bookkeeping — debits always equal credits
4. Audit log every financial event — immutable, append-only
5. Fail safe — on error, roll back fully or do nothing
6. Never store card PANs — use tokenization providers
7. Assume network failures — design for exactly-once delivery

Double-Entry Ledger Design
-- Ledger accounts tableCREATE TABLE accounts (
id UUID PRIMARY KEYDEFAULT gen_random_uuid(),
type TEXT NOT NULLCHECK (type IN ('asset', 'liability', 'equity', 'revenue', 'expense')),
name TEXT NOT NULL,
currency TEXT NOT NULLDEFAULT'USD',
created_at TIMESTAMPTZ NOT NULLDEFAULT NOW()
);
-- Immutable ledger entries (double-entry)CREATE TABLE ledger_entries (
id UUID PRIMARY KEYDEFAULT gen_random_uuid(),
transaction_id UUID NOT NULL, -- Groups debit+credit pairs
account_id UUID NOT NULLREFERENCES accounts(id),
amount BIGINTNOT NULL, -- Positive = debit, Negative = credit
currency TEXT NOT NULL,
description TEXT,
reference_type TEXT, -- 'payment', 'refund', 'fee', etc.
reference_id TEXT, -- External ID (Stripe charge ID, etc.)
created_at TIMESTAMPTZ NOT NULLDEFAULT NOW(),
-- Ledger entries are NEVER updated or deletedCONSTRAINT no_zero_amount CHECK (amount !=0)
);
-- Account balance view (computed from ledger)CREATEVIEW account_balances ASSELECT
account_id,
currency,
SUM(amount) AS balance
FROM ledger_entries
GROUPBY account_id, currency;

For European payments, handle SCA challenges properly:
// On frontend: handle requires_action statusconst { paymentIntent, error } = await stripe.confirmCardPayment(clientSecret);
if (paymentIntent?.status === 'requires_action') {
// Stripe.js handles 3DS challenge automatically// Server webhook will fire payment_intent.succeeded when complete
}
// Never mark order as paid until webhook payment_intent.succeeded fires// Frontend confirmation is NOT authoritative
